Canadian Federal Census Dates
In most cases, the following list indicates the official enumeration dates for the various census returns. The actual enumeration of the population took weeks or months. Enumerators were instructed to record the information on the census returns as it existed on the official enumeration date.
| 1825 | Lower Canada (Quebec) taken from June 20 to September 20, 1825 |
| 1831 | Lower Canada (Quebec) taken from June 1 to October 1, 1831 |
| 1842 | Canada West (Ontario) returns were supposed to be completed by February 1, 1842 |
| 1851 | January 12, 1852 (delays led to the late enumeration of the 1851 Census) |
| 1861 | January 14, 1861 |
| 1871 | April 2, 1871 |
| 1881 | April 4, 1881 |
| 1891 | April 6,1891 |
| 1901 | March 31, 1901 |
| 1906 | June 24, 1906 |
| 1911 | June 1, 1911 |
This information was compiled from Library and Archives Canada
